Philosophy
We owe out love of wisdom to the ancient Greeks! The word philosophy can be broken down into two parts; phil meaning "love" and sophy meaning "wisdom." Combined, the two elements mean both a love of wisdom and a desire for it. In English, philosophy first appears in writing as early as 1340 so there is a wealth of literature here. Philosophy has been around since ancient times so there is no shortage of literary material. Some of the most important historical works are philosophy books and include contributions from Socrates, Plato and Aristotle, although this is really just scratching the surface when it comes down to the great ancient works.

Whether you are looking for an ancient work or something more modern, there will be something out there to suit you! When talking about something more complicated it could be worth getting a commentary or study guide to help you along the way.

Buying New or Second Hand?
When investing in books it's worth considering buying them second hand. The larger reference type books can often be quite expensive and so you could save yourself some money by choosing a second hand option. Because the books will be cheaper this could mean you'll be able to make your money go further. Second hand books are also the obvious choice if the title you are looking for is out of print. The best way to go about tracking down an out of print book is to contact a specialist second hand book seller, as they will be more familiar with the most appropriate ways to search for the book you require.

Buying second hand is also the green option; it's far better to recycle. If someone has books they no longer need then it's a shame to have them go to waste, and it's much nicer for them to be passed on to give enjoyment and utility to someone else. However there are a few things to consider when buying second hand. Be aware that these are not new items so don't be disappointed if something has a 'worn-in' feel. Also read the advert carefully to make sure you know exactly what you are buying, and check the terms and conditions; these will probably be down to the individual seller. Don't be afraid of contacting them to ask about the item and make sure you feel comfortable with the price you are paying. Most people will want to get rid of the items they are advertising and should be willing to help; if they won't, then perhaps question their motives.
